Discover The Kingslodge Inn, a 3-star inn in Durham, United Kingdom. Located at Flass Vale, Waddington Street, it sits about 0.5mi from Durham’s city center. Minimum price starts from $116.
With 2,207 reviews, this inn blends comfort with practical conveniences. Featured amenities include pet-friendly options (extra charges), an on-site restaurant, free private parking, and free Wi-Fi; a bar and garden also add to the atmosphere. Non-smoking rooms, wheelchair accessibility, and free toiletries are available, and kids’ meals are offered for an extra charge.

Our four-night stay at the Kingslodge Inn in Durham was very satisfactory. Our room was reasonably large, it was quiet, and the bed was excellent. The room was fairly bright, it was clean, and there were two bedside lamps. Staff were friendly and helpful; checking in and checking out were easy. Our room was properly serviced each day. The curtains were light-blocking -- important when the sun rises at 04:30 AM. The bathroom was moderately large and benefitted from a well-made, modern shower stall. There was a very satisfactory range of foodstuffs available at breakfast, and everything was well-organized and nicely presented. Egg dishes were cooked to order. The restaurant is open long hours, and our one evening meal was tasty and reasonably priced.
The Kingslodge Inn falls somewhat short of its potential. Relatively inexpensive improvements would have made our room more comfortable. For instance, the bathroom, though large, has no shelf or cabinet of any sort. (Apparently guests are not expected to have toothbrushes, combs, razors, or cosmetics . . . ) Even the rim of the washbasin is narrow. There is only one rather small towel bar and one hook on the back of the bathroom door. There are two bedtables. However, they are small; there would be sufficient place for larger bedtables. The Kingslodge might not be well suited for individuals with mobility constraints. There is no lift/elevator, and stairways are fairly narrow. On the other hand, parking is conveniently located.

Everything was lovely. I asked for a quiet room and we got one; it also gave a view of the woods behind the hotel. In addition, the room was warm and spacious with a very comfortable bed. The menu was varied enough for 3 nights or more and the buffet breakfasts plentiful. The cooked breakfast dishes were nicely cooked and presented. There was little or no delay in service and we didn't feel 'rushed' at any of the meals. I asked for a light bulb to be changed as it was very dim and flickered and this had been seen to by the time we got back in the evening. The location of the hotel is just right being on the fringe of the main tourist area but totally walkable from the train station (10-15 minutes) in one direction and into town in the other. It is in a cul de sac with Flass Vale woods behind and therefore quiet. We liked the ambience of the whole place inside and out.
Only very small observations which didn't impact all that adversely on our stay: The decor is a little dated and could do with a face-lift; our shower room had no radiator so was a little chilly when getting out of the shower (though I admit I am a wimp and it was 4 degrees C outside); occasionally one or two components of some meals were a little on the cool side as if they'd been kept waiting - eg, mushy peas/poached eggs; the walk into town is not great with a couple of very busy roads to cross and no pedestrian crossings - totally not the hotel's fault of course!
